What is Global Industrial Joysticks Market?
The Global Industrial Joysticks Market is a vast and dynamic sector that encompasses a wide range of products and applications. Industrial joysticks are manual control devices used in various industrial applications such as cranes, trucks, and other heavy machinery. They are designed to control multiple functions of equipment with precision and ease. The global market for these devices is substantial, with a wide array of manufacturers and suppliers catering to diverse industries worldwide. The market's value stood at a significant US$ 463 million in 2022, and it is projected to grow steadily, reaching an estimated value of US$ 636.7 million by 2029. This growth is expected to occur at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.6%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2029. The market is dominated by three major manufacturers who collectively hold a market share of approximately 35%.

Electric Industrial Joysticks, Hydraulic Industrial Joysticks, Others in the Global Industrial Joysticks Market:
In the Global Industrial Joysticks Market, there are several types of joysticks, including Electric Industrial Joysticks, Hydraulic Industrial Joysticks, and others. Each type has its unique features and applications. Electric Industrial Joysticks are typically used in applications that require precise control and fast response times. They are often found in industries such as robotics, medical devices, and gaming. On the other hand, Hydraulic Industrial Joysticks are used in heavy-duty applications that require robust and durable control devices. These are commonly used in construction, mining, and other heavy industries. The 'Others' category includes a variety of specialized joysticks designed for specific applications or industries. Despite the diversity in types, Hydraulic Industrial Joysticks dominate the market, holding a share of over 45%.
Agricultural and Forestry, Construction, Marine, Other in the Global Industrial Joysticks Market:
The Global Industrial Joysticks Market finds its applications in various sectors, including Agricultural and Forestry, Construction, Marine, and others. In the Agricultural and Forestry sector, industrial joysticks are used to control heavy machinery such as tractors, harvesters, and forestry equipment. They allow operators to control multiple functions of the machinery with precision and ease, increasing efficiency and productivity. In the Construction sector, industrial joysticks are used in equipment like cranes, excavators, and loaders. They provide precise control over the machinery, enhancing safety and efficiency on construction sites. The Marine sector uses industrial joysticks to control various types of marine vessels, including ships, submarines, and remotely operated vehicles. They offer precise control over the vessel's movement and operations, improving safety and efficiency at sea. Other sectors also use industrial joysticks for various applications, demonstrating the versatility and wide-ranging applicability of these devices.
